What Are the Key Types of eVisas Available?

Electronic Visas (eVisas) are a smart solution, and they're typically categorized based on your primary purpose for visiting the destination country. While specific names vary, most eVisas fall under these general types:

  1. Tourist eVisa: Granted when your main goal is leisure, sightseeing, visiting friends/relatives, or attending short-term recreational programs. This is the most common eVisa type for vacationers.
  2. Business eVisa: Issued for commercial activities like attending conferences, meetings, conducting negotiations, or scouting investment opportunities. Remember, this visa strictly prohibits paid employment within the country.
  3. Transit eVisa: Designed for travelers making a quick stopover while en route to a final destination. The duration is very limited (often just 1-4 days).
  4. Long-Stay eVisa: Covers extended visits, often required for education, long-term business projects, or any purpose that needs a stay beyond the standard 30-90 day limit.
  5. Specialized eVisas: These can include types like Family Visit, Medical, or Conference eVisas, tailored to very specific circumstances requiring specialized documentation.


What Documentation is Commonly Required for an eVisa?

Requirements shift depending on the country and visa type, but you should always be ready with:

  • Passport: A clear digital scan of the bio page (with minimum required validity, usually 6 months).
  • Photo: A recent, high-quality passport-style photograph.
  • Proof of Travel Arrangements (if applicable): Confirmed flight reservations showing your entry and exit from the country.
  • Accommodation Proof (if applicable): Confirmed hotel bookings or an invitation/letter from a host covering your entire stay.
  • Evidence of Financial Sufficiency (if applicable): Bank statements or other documents proving you can comfortably cover your expenses during your adventure.
  • Invitation Letter: Required specifically for business or sponsored visit visas.

Should You Choose an eVisa or a Visa on Arrival (VoA)?

While many African nations, including some listed here Egypt for certain nationalities, still offer a DRC Congo Visa on Arrival (VoA), you need to know the crucial differences:

  • eVisa (Electronic): This is pre-approved travel authorization. You apply and get approved online before you even depart, essentially guaranteeing entry (subject to standard checks).
  • VoA (On Arrival): The visa is issued at the point of entry. This often means standing in long, tiring queues, filling out paper forms, and risking denial if documentation is incomplete or rules have changed.
  • Recommendation: Always for the eVisa if available. It ensures a smooth, pre-cleared arrival and minimizes delays at the border, letting your adventure start sooner.


What Makes This Maghreb Majesty Unique Morocco's Ancient Soul?

Morocco, perfectly positioned at the crossroads of Europe and Africa, is a stunning cultural mosaic defined by its potent blend of Islamic, Andalusian, and indigenous Berber heritage. It’s a sensory overload of sound, scent, and colour that calls to millions of travelers annually.


What is the Labyrinthine Charm of Moroccan Medinas?

The ancient walled cities (Medinas) are the vibrant, pounding heart of Morocco, defined by their historical weight and intoxicating atmosphere:

  • Fez el Bali: A UNESCO World Heritage site and famously the world’s most extensive urban car-free zone, it features a truly fascinating, tangled labyrinth of alleyways, artisanal workshops, and historic madrassas just waiting to be explored.
  • Djemaa el-Fna (Marrakech): The square transforms nightly into a colossal, unforgettable carnival of storytellers, snake charmers, and sizzling street food vendors, offering the most immersive taste of Moroccan life you can find.
  • Essential Cultural Practices: The deep ritual of the Hammam (public bath) and the ubiquitous offering of sweet mint tea encapsulate the nation's profound hospitality and warm social traditions.


How is Morocco's eVisa Defined Types, Validity?

Morocco has successfully streamlined its entry process through the electronic visa system. Understanding its structure is your key to a smooth application:

EVISA TYPES:

  • Tourist eVisa: Issued for leisure and sightseeing activities.
  • Business eVisa: Issued for conferences, meetings, or other commercial engagements.

VALIDITY AND STAY:

  • Validity: 180 Days (from the date of issue).
  • Duration of Stay: 30 Days (maximum stay permitted per entry).


Why is it Called Africa in Miniature Cameroon's Vibrant Diversity?

Cameroon is a cultural powerhouse, justly earning its nickname by boasting a stunning geographic variety—from beaches to mountains and savannahs—which in turn hosts over 250 distinct ethnic groups and languages. It's truly a world in one country.


How diverse is Cameroon's Linguistic and Ethnic Kaleidoscope?

Cameroon's immense diversity translates into rich and wonderfully varying traditions:

  • Regional Contrast: The North is home to powerful Islamic Sultanates, while the South and West are characterized by traditional chiefdoms and unique forest-dwelling communities like the Baka people.
  • Festivals and Ceremonies: These vibrant public events are marked by unique tribal masks, elaborate costumes, and rhythmic, moving traditional dances.
  • Linguistic Hub: This cultural melting pot is mirrored in its official languages, French and English, making it a pivotal social and economic link between Francophone and Anglophone Africa.


What Traditional Arts and Music Define Cameroon?

Cameroon Cultures and Traditions is explosive in artistic expression:

  • Traditional Arts: The nation is renowned for intricate woodworking, powerful bronze sculptures, and traditional masks used in essential ceremonial rites.
  • Music as the Social Backbone: Music forms the core of social life, with styles gaining significant international recognition.
  • Makossa and Bikutsi: Key genres like Makossa (from Douala) and Bikutsi (from the Centre region) perfectly blend traditional percussion with modern instrumentation, offering a lively reflection of the nation's energy.


How Do Travelers Navigate the Cameroon eVisa Process?

Cameroon's eVisa system is accommodating, providing flexibility for different needs and duration of stay:

EVISA TYPES:

  • Transit eVisa: For short stopovers.
  • Short-stay eVisa: For typical tourism or brief visits.
  • Long-stay eVisa: For extended visits, education, or long-term business projects.

VALIDITY AND STAY:

  • Transit eVisa: 1 to 4 Days
  • Short-stay eVisa: 0 to 6 months
  • Long-stay eVisa: 6 months to 1 year


What Defines the Heart of Central Africa The Republic of the Congo?

The Republic of the Congo (Congo-Brazzaville) offers a captivating blend of pristine rainforest ecology and a distinct, striking urban culture, particularly in its capital city.


Who are the Sapeurs and What is Their Style Phenomenon?

The Sapeurs culture (Society of Ambiance-Makers and Elegant People) is a sophisticated cornerstone of Congolese identity:

  1. Defining Element: Impeccably dressed Congolese individuals who elevate fashion, tailoring, and presentation to a high art form.
  2. Social Statement: They use brightly colored, often high-end designer clothes as a non-violent, powerful form of social and artistic expression.
  3. Cultural Fusion: The movement is a stylish blend of colonial history, innate sartorial elegance, and performance art, centered around showing dignity and creativity in the face of adversity.
  4. Rural Contrast: Beyond the city, the culture is deeply connected to the rainforests, home to the Baka Pygmy communities, whose ancient traditions offer a striking, beautiful contrast to the urban flair.


What Are the Pathways for Discovering the Congo eVisa?

The Republic of the Congo offers specialized eVisa categories, often dubbed "Flying eVisas," suggesting an application process specifically tailored for air travel entry:

EVISA TYPES:

  • Specific Flying eVisa: Generally for highly specific travel reasons or official visits.
  • Ordinary Flying eVisa: Standard e-visa for general purposes not covered by specific tourist or business types.
  • Tourist eVisa: For leisure travel and exploration.
  • Business eVisa: For commercial activities, meetings, or trade shows.
  • Transit eVisa: For short stopovers while en route to another destination.
  • Family Visit Flying eVisa: For visiting relatives or family members residing in the Congo.


VALIDITY AND STAY:

  • Validity: 180 Days (from the date of issue).
  • Duration of Stay: 30 Days (maximum stay permitted per entry).
